Database Interaction

What is Database Interaction?

Database interaction is the process of communicating with a database to store, retrieve, and manage data. It allows users and applications to send requests to the database and get the information needed.

Understanding Database Interaction

Databases are systems that organize and store data in a structured way. With database interaction, you can perform many tasks, including:

  • Adding Data: This is known as inserting data into the database. For example, you might add new customer information to a database.

  • Retrieving Data: This involves fetching data from the database. For instance, if you want to see a list of all registered users, you will retrieve this information from the database.

  • Updating Data: Sometimes, you need to change existing data. This is called updating. If a customer changes their address, you would update their information in the database.

  • Deleting Data: If data is no longer needed, it can be removed from the database. This process is known as deleting.

Topics and Subtopics in Database Interaction

Understanding database interaction involves several key topics and subtopics. Here's an outline of the main areas to explore:

1. Database Fundamentals

  • What is a Database?: Definition and types (relational and non-relational)
  • Database Management Systems (DBMS): Overview of popular DBMS like MySQL, PostgreSQL, and Microsoft SQL Server

2. SQL (Structured Query Language)

  • Basic SQL Commands: SELECT, INSERT, UPDATE, DELETE
  • Advanced SQL Techniques: Joins, Subqueries, and Group By clauses
  • Data Types: Understanding different data types used in databases

3. Data Manipulation

  • CRUD Operations: Create, Read, Update, Delete actions
  • Transactions: Understanding ACID properties (Atomicity, Consistency, Isolation, Durability)

4. Data Retrieval

  • Query Optimization: Techniques to make queries run faster
  • Indexing: How to use indexes to improve data retrieval

5. Data Security

  • Authentication and Authorization: Ensuring only authorized users can access data
  • Data Encryption: Protecting sensitive data within databases

6. Database Design

  • Normalization: Organizing data to reduce redundancy
  • Entity-Relationship Diagrams (ERD): Visual representation of data relationships

7. Integration with Applications

  • APIs and Database Interaction: How applications communicate with databases
  • ORM (Object-Relational Mapping): Frameworks that help translate database data into application objects

How Database Interaction is Used

Database interaction is a critical component in various fields and applications, serving as the backbone for effective data management. Here are some common ways that database interaction is used:

1. Business Operations

Many businesses rely on database interaction to manage customer information, sales data, and inventory levels. By using SQL queries, companies can quickly retrieve reports, track performance metrics, and analyze trends to make informed decisions.

2. Web Applications

Websites and online platforms use database interaction to manage user data, such as registration details, content preferences, and activity logs. For instance, an e-commerce site needs to interact with a database to handle product listings, customer orders, and payment processes, ensuring a smooth user experience.

3. Data Analysis

Data analysts use database interaction to access large datasets needed for analysis. They write complex queries to extract specific information, perform calculations, and generate reports. This process helps organizations derive insights from data, guiding strategic planning and growth.

4. Mobile Applications

Mobile apps often connect to databases to store and retrieve user data. For example, a social media app relies on database interaction to manage user profiles, messages, and interactions. This functionality allows users to engage with the app seamlessly.

5. Healthcare Management

In healthcare, databases store patient records, treatment histories, and billing information. Database interaction is crucial for healthcare professionals to access patient data quickly, ensuring timely medical care and accurate record-keeping.

6. Customer Relationship Management (CRM)

CRMs use database interaction to track customer interactions, manage leads, and store vital information about client relationships. This enables sales teams to access relevant data easily and tailor their approach to individual clients.
